A few weeks ago, I had the privilege of attending an event at Restaurant.com‘s headquarters to learn more about the company, their website, and some great offers they have going on for the holidays. In case you are unfamiliar with Restaurant.com, they offer restaurant gift certificates at a discounted price. For example, most $25 restaurant gift certificates only cost $10. They also often have promo codes to get an even deeper discount. I especially love to purchase gift certificates from Restaurant.com for gifts! You can choose gift certificates for specific restaurants (over 18,000 nationwide) or get general gift cards or eGift cards to send by email.
I have been using Restaurant.com for a few years now, but I thought it was interesting to learn that there is no money passed between the company and the restaurants. Restaurant.com is simply a way for restaurants to attract more customers by offering their gift certificates at a discounted rate. The cost is controlled by putting a minimum for each purchase when a gift certificate is used. I think the idea is pretty clever!
I have not used a Restaurant.com gift certificate for myself in awhile (we usually buy them for gifts to others), but I was happy to find out that they now have restaurant reviews on their website. The neat thing about it is that they are able to verify whether or not a reviewer actually ate at a restaurant and will only let a review be submitted if that reviewer used a Restaurant.com gift certificate at that particular restaurant. This ensures that the review is really authentic and trustworthy!

A couple of weeks ago, I had the privilege of attending an event at HoneyBaked Ham in Naperville, IL to learn more about the company and what they have to offer. Did you know that HoneyBaked Ham does way more than just ham for the holidays? Their ham is super delicious, but they also offer sides, other meats, and desserts that can be packaged as a lunch for one person, dinner for family, catering order, etc. I received a HoneyBaked Ham dinner to take home for my family and me to try, but before I get to that, here is some interesting information I learned about HoneyBaked Ham:
- Their goal is to dinner easy and affordable for the busy parent.
- As mentioned above, HoneyBaked carries more than just ham. They have pork, beef, turkey roasts, ribs, shredded beef and pork in barbecue sauce for sandwiches, deli sides, desserts, whole turkeys, turkey breasts, thin sliced honey bacon, and more.
- HoneyBaked does catering for personal and businesses. They have options for every occasion.
- Their bread is delivered fresh daily from Highland bakery, and their produce is delivered fresh 3 times a week.
- HoneyBaked makes your holiday dinner easy. They have everything you will need to make your holiday dinner a success from the main course, side dishes and dessert, without the hassle of doing all the work.
- HoneyBaked has 2 loyalty programs: Buy five dinners and get the 6th for 50% off (dinner card), or buy five lunch boxes and get the 6th for FREE (lunch box card).
- They also have a fundraising program with fundraising coupon books that include $70 worth of coupons. HoneyBaked sells the book to you for $3 and you sell them for $7. That is a 57% profit your organization.
